The City worked with ETC Institute (ETC), a survey research firm, to gather statistically valid and representative input from City of Eugene residents on a wide variety of issues and topics.
Survey Goals
The survey was conducted to help City leadership determine how best to support the community and the organization’s goals and to help with future budget decision making.
Survey Design
In August 2022, ETC mailed surveys to a random, representative sample of households in Eugene, resulting in a statistically valid set of survey responses and a demographic make-up which aligns with the community’s demographics. In addition to the mail-in option, people were also given the option to take the ETC survey online. In total, ETC received 958 completed survey responses.
Additional Survey
In addition to ETC’s statistically valid sample, the City administered a similar survey, in both English and Spanish, through the Engage Eugene web platform, which received 815 combined responses.
City Council Work Session
Data from the online public opinion surveys as well as the ETC findings was presented at a City Council Work Session on Wednesday, September 21, 2022.
